| Stokes
County Arts Council Announces Scholarship
The Stokes County Arts Council announces a scholarship available
to Stokes County residents. The SCAC Scholarship was established
to assist a worthy young individual in pursuing his or her artistic
goals in higher education.
These yearly scholarships are awarded to Stokes
County residents graduating from one of the County high schools,
who will be planning to major in an arts-related field. A student
currently attending an institution of higher learning with the
same career goals may also apply. An institution of higher learning
approved by the Scholarship Committee must have already accepted
the student.
The 2010 Scholarship amount to be awarded
is $1,500. The amount awarded to a recipient(s) is based upon
the financial need of the applicant. The recipient may reapply
every year. The scholarship will be paid directly to the institution.
The winner(s) will be selected by a five-member
committee with two being members of the SCAC Board of Directors
and three being from the community at large. No immediate relative
of an applicant may serve on the committee.
The decision of the committee is final.
